Google-UChicago-UTokyo Quantum Workshop” will be held on Monday, May 22nd, 2023, jointly organized by Google, the University of Chicago, and the University of Tokyo, where we will discuss recent developments and applications of quantum computing.
Dr. Hartmut Neven, Engineering Director of Google Quantum AI, will visit UTokyo on May 22nd, and we take this opportunity to jointly organize the workshop with researchers from UChicago and UTokyo.
Dr. Neven will talk about Google’s roadmap and the current status of quantum computing, including some recent results. The researchers from UChicago and UTokyo will also present their perspectives and plan on quantum science.
 
The workshop will be held in English.
